As a Behavior Therapist, you will be responsible for:

  • Protecting the rights and dignities of individuals with developmental disabilities and extending these rights and dignities to family members or guardians.
  • Implementing behavior analysis educational and treatment programs of individual children with special healthcare needs in a clinic setting under the direction of the Lead Therapist and Program Director or designated Behavior Analyst.
  • Committing to organizational quality initiatives by participating in programs that will assure quality improvements and team processes, including regular attendance at training and staff meetings.
  • Assisting at whatever level necessary to meet the goals outlined in the treatment plan with consultation from the Behavior Analyst. Collecting data as assigned by the Behavior Analyst about goals.
  • Arriving to work on time, ensuring time for necessary communication with families to occur. Reviewing treatment logs at the beginning and end of all shifts.
  • Meeting with Lead Therapist and Behavior Analyst to review and discuss family issues, scheduling issues, and the administration of the plan.
  • Implementing instructional strategies consistently and accurately as prescribed by the Lead Therapist, Program Director, and/or Behavior Analyst.
  • Communicating any medical, physical, or other changes in student status to guardian and Lead Therapist.
  • Coordinating activities when the Lead Therapist is absent, as designated by the Program Coordinator and/or Behavior Analyst.
  • Facilitating all aspects of the child’s Treatment Plan, including self-care and toileting skills using positive approaches and remembering that each person has individual needs and learning styles.
  • Assisting in the training and orientation of new staff; providing co-workers with positive and constructive feedback.
  • Performing all other duties and job assignments as required by the Director and Lead Therapist.

Education/ Requirements:

  • Must be at least 19 years of age and have a high school diploma or equivalent.
  • Bachelor’s degree in education, special education, or related field preferred.
  • Experience working with children in a teaching capacity is also preferred.
  • Must be eager to learn and able to receive feedback/specific direction from supervisors.
  • Must demonstrate competency to work with children with special health care needs as evidenced by active participation in department-specific formal training.
  • Must successfully pass BCI and CANTs screenings.
  • Valid driver’s license, safe driving record, and automobile insurance preferred.
